Here’s how to specify the USB driver that will be used when the
JUNO-STAGE is connected to your computer via the USB MIDI
connector.
If you want to change this setting, disconnect the USB cable
before doing so.
1.
Press [MENU].
2.
Use [
] [
] to select “1. System” and press the [ENTER].
3.
Press [2 (GENERAL)].
4.
Press [2 (COMMON)].
5.
Use the cursor buttons to move the cursor to “USB Driver.”
6.
Use the VALUE dial or [DEC] [INC] to specify the driver.
A confirmation message will appear.
Press [7 (CLOSE)] to return to the previous screen.
7.
Press the [7 (WRITE)] button.
8.
Turn the power off, then on again.
If you change the “USB Driver” setting, you must turn the power
off, then on again to ensure that the JUNO-STAGE will operate
correctly.
The included JUNO-STAGE Editor/Librarian/Playlist Editor software
will help you enjoy the full potential of the JUNO-STAGE.
JUNO-STAGE Editor lets you use your computer to edit the JUNO-
STAGE’s sounds and other settings. Parameters can be assigned to
sliders and knobs in the screen of your computer, allowing you to edit
efficiently in a graphical manner.
JUNO-STAGE Librarian is software that lets you manage the JUNO-
STAGE’s parameters as a library on your computer, allowing efficient
management of patches, rhythm sets, and performances.
Playlist Editor is software that lets you create playlists for the Song
Player (p. 68).
Carefully read the Readme file in the “JUNO-STAGE Editor CD” CD-
ROM included with the JUNO-STAGE, and install JUNO-STAGE
Editor/Librarian/Playlist Editor as directed.

Specifying the USB Driver
Parameter
Value
Explanation
USB Driver
VENDER
Choose this if you want to use a
USB driver from the included
CD-ROM or a USB driver
downloaded from the Roland
website.
GENERIC
Choose this if you want to use
the generic USB driver provided
by your computer’s operating
system.
